Aufgabe Verbesserte Validierung der Server-Adresse bei der Bearbeitung von Mailkonten
Bei der Bearbeitung von Mailkonten sollen die eingetragenen Server-Adressen (für IMAP- / POP3- / SMTP-Server) besser validiert werden.
So wird z.B. momentan die Eingabe "test@test.de" als gültige Server-Adresse akzeptiert und gespeichert. Ein Verbindungs-Aufbau / -Test führt in diesem Falle zu folgender Fehlermeldung:
Fehler: IMAP test failed!
Contains non-LDH characters.
gnu.inet.encoding.IDNAException: Contains non-LDH characters.
at gnu.inet.encoding.IDNA.toASCII(IDNA.java:118):57)
at com.openindex.openestate.tool.mail.io.ImapReader.createSession(ImapReader.java:74):222)
at com.openindex.openestate.tool.mail.io.ImapPanel$2.executeTask(ImapPanel.java:207):75)
at javax.swing.SwingWorker$1.call(Unknown Source)
at java.util.concurrent.FutureTask$Sync.innerRun(Unknown Source)
at java.util.concurrent.FutureTask.run(Unknown Source)
at javax.swing.SwingWorker.run(Unknown Source)
at java.util.concurrent.ThreadPoolExecutor.runWorker(Unknown Source)
at java.util.concurrent.ThreadPoolExecutor$Worker.run(Unknown Source)
at java.lang.Thread.run(Unknown Source)
Eckdaten
- Zugewiesene Version
- 1.0-beta25
- Status
- erledigt
- Auflösung
- korrigiert
- Priorität
- normal
- Schweregrad
- Feature-Wunsch
- Aufwand
- keine Angabe
- Reproduzierbarkeit
- nicht anwendbar
- zuletzt bearbeitet am
- erzeugt am